Product Overview

Category

The ADG507AKR-REEL7 belongs to the category of analog multiplexers/demultiplexers.

Use

This product is commonly used in electronic circuits for signal routing and switching applications. It allows multiple input signals to be selectively connected to a single output or vice versa.

Working Principles

The ADG507AKR-REEL7 operates based on the principle of MOSFET-based analog switching. When a control signal is applied, the corresponding channel is connected to the common pin, allowing the passage of signals. The low on-resistance ensures minimal signal attenuation and distortion.
